The Washington Nationals (4-12) will send one of their better pitchers to the mound on Friday when they take on the Florida Marlins (9-6) in a National League game that is set to begin at 7:10 PM ET at Dolphin Stadium in Miami.
The Nationals will send right-hander Tim Redding (2-1, 2.25 ERA) to the mound, while the Marlins counter with left-hander Andrew Miller (0-2, 11.37 ERA).

Washington lost a heart-breaker to the Mets last night (3-2 in 14 innings) to bring their current losing streak to three games. It was their 12th setback in the last 13.
Tim Redding was a little shaky against the Braves last time out (April 13), allowing nine base runners in five innings of work, but he directed the Nationals to its only win during a nearly two-week period. In his first two appearances, he gave up one earned run in 11 innings. One of those games was at Nationals Park against this Florida team - a bizarre outing in which he gave up seven hits and seven runs in four innings, with only one of those runs earned.
Andrew Miller's WHIP ratio is a whopping 2.45, and he's already given up 16 runs in 12-2/3 innings. Interestingly enough, he's got a strikeout-to-walk ratio of better than 2-to-1 (15 K's, 7 BB's). he has been hit hard in all three of his starts, surrendering 24 hits.
But does he provide the solution for Washington's offensive woes? The Nats have scored 14 runs in their last seven games, and in 14 innings they had only six hits on Thursday night. There is just no offensive spark, and seemingly nowhere to find it. But it’s not so unusual, since Washington was last in the league in runs scored last season.
